Está en la página 1de 6

I

TALLER: PRUEBA DE SOFTWARE I

Aprendiz

Julian Esteban Grajales Vergara

Instructora

Heidy Alejandra Celis Trujillo

Aplicación de la calidad del software en el proceso de desarrollo.

SERVICIO NACIONAL DE APRENDIZAJE SENA

“SENA VIRTUAL”

2021
Actividad

En esta prueba se solicita adelantar la evaluación de un software según características

especificadas por el cliente. Análisis que se deberá completar en un documento de formato Word,

siguiendo estas pautas:

1. Descargar el archivo adjunto, dispuesto en el enlace ‘Actividad 2’, material de apoyo

Descripción de la solicitud del software de facturación, el cual servirá de referente sobre

requerimientos del cliente para aplicar análisis en el software proporcionado para esta actividad.

2. Descargar el programa de software adjunto e identificar los posibles errores

que pueda contener de acuerdo con las solicitudes planteadas.

3. Realizar un análisis y diligenciar la tabla de registro de tiempos según el siguiente

modelo:

4. Determinar las modificaciones que se considere pertinentes para los errores

encontrados en el programa (registrar dicha información en la tabla de tiempos).


Se debe enviar el resultado en un documento de Word a través de la plataforma siguiendo la

ruta: Menú principal, ‘Actividad 2’, Evidencia de producto. Taller: ‘Prueba de software 1’.
Si al momento de enviar la evidencia, el sistema genera el error indicando: ‘Archivo

Inválido’, esto es debido a que el archivo se encuentra abierto, se debe cerrar y probar

nuevamente dando clic en ‘Adjuntar archivo’, ‘Examinar mi equipo’.


Desarrollo

Hora
Tiempo de descripción
Fecha Inici Tiempo Comentario C U
Fin Interrupción Actividad
O
14/11/202 16:29 17:0 13 38 análisis de calidad: Se analiza la funcionalidad del
1 7 FUNCIONALIDAD programa.
después de realizar varias pruebas de
escritorio se llega a la conclusión de
que el programa no es funcional, ya
que este solo cumple con el resultado X 1
en 8 de 18 pruebas realizadas.
Presenta problemas de cálculo
matemático.

14/11/202 17:09 17:1 0 5 análisis de calidad: Se analiza la portabilidad del


1 4 PORTABILIDAD programa.
Al tratarse de un archivo ejecutable
(.exe) solo se podría ejecutar en un S.O X 1
como Windows, Linux o IOS, por lo
cual podemos decir que esta aplicación
no es portable.
14/11/202 17:15 17:1 0 3 análisis de calidad: Se analiza la mantenibilidad del
1 8 MANTENIBILIDA programa.
D Al tratarse de un programa pequeño se
puede decir que este podría tener
actualizaciones las cuales mejorarían
su calidad, siempre y cuando se tenga X 1
el código para realizar las
modificaciones pertinentes

14/11/202 17:20 17:2 0 3 análisis de calidad: Se analiza la eficiencia del programa.


1 3 EFICIENCIA No consume demasiado recursos de
maquina ya que se ejecuta en consola, X 1
responde con rapidez.

14/11/202 17:26 17:3 2 9 análisis de calidad: Se analiza la usabilidad del programa.


01 5 USABILIDAD No cumple para nada con este aspecto,
al ejecutarse en consola suele carecer
de una interfaz gráfica elegante y
atractiva.
No muestra mensajes sobre la
siguiente acción que deberíamos
realizar después de ingresar un dato X 1
(no nos menciona que al terminar de
ingresar el dato debemos digitar el
ENTER).
14/11/202 17:37 17:4 1 8 análisis de calidad: Se analiza la fiabilidad del programa.
1 5 FIABILIDAD No tiene capacidad de recuperación
ante los fallos, se cierra ante una
eventual falla o error.
Si existe un error al momento de
digitar un dato este se cierra.
Si al escribir el nombre existen
espacios, no deja ingresar más datos y
se cierra. X 1
Si se sobrepasa la longitud Máxima
de un dato (la cual no nos mencionan)
no deja ingresar más datos y se cierra.

14/11/202 17:52 18:11 3 19 análisis de calidad: En aspectos de funcionalidad es


1 recomendaciones de menester que el programa funcione
modificación correctamente, con esto se hace
necesarias referencia a que realice los cálculos
matemáticos correctamente y ubique
los datos en las posiciones correctas al
momentos de mostrarlo al usuario.
En cuestión de portabilidad se podría
llevar esta funcionalidad a diferentes
plataformas pero posiblemente exista
mucha diferencia en el aspecto gráfico.
Se debería realizar una versión nueva
del programa.
Mantener el programa lo más eficiente
posible en aspectos de requisitos de
máquina.
Si bien es un programa que se ejecuta
en consola, este debería contar al
menos con instrucciones básicas que le
digan al usuario que acción es la X 1
siguiente a realizar.
Corregir en el aspecto de ingreso de
datos, si alguien comete un error
(sobrepasar cantidad Máxima de
caracteres, ingresar espacios)al
momento de ingresar un dato que el
programa tenga capacidad de volver a
solicitar esa información, y que
además le informe al usuario que error
tuvo para este no seguir cometiéndolo.

También podría gustarte